chronometry

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. Synonym of horology: the study of time, particularly the science, art, and technology of time measurement.

Word forms

chronometry chronometries

Etymology

From chrono- + -metry on the model of chronometer, q.v., ultimately from Ancient Greek χρόνος (khrónos, “time”) and μέτρον (métron, “meter, measuring device”).
